Tony Brown Bio
Tony M. Brown Jr. is an American professional football cornerback born on July 13, 1995, in Beaumont, Texas. He played college football for the Alabama Crimson Tide and became known as an undrafted free agent signing with the Los Angeles Chargers in 2018. Over his career, he has played for multiple teams in the NFL, including the Green Bay Packers, Cincinnati Bengals, and Indianapolis Colts, before joining the Cleveland Browns in 2024.
Early Life and Background
Tony M. Brown Jr. attended Clifton J. Ozen High School in Beaumont, Texas, where he excelled in football and track. As a freshman in 2010, he made 95 tackles, had one interception, and broke up 15 passes. His sophomore year was equally impressive, with 96 tackles and three interceptions, along with a fumble recovery and 16 pass breakups. Brown was also a standout track athlete, winning a silver medal in the 110-meter hurdles at the 2013 Pan American Junior Championships in Medellín, Colombia. He was named to the USA Today All-American Track and Field Team and won the state title in the 110-meter hurdles at the 2013 Texas Class 4A Meet.
Path to American Football
Considered a five-star football recruit by ESPN.com, Tony Brown was listed as the No. 2 cornerback in the nation in 2014. He committed to the University of Alabama at the 2014 Under Armour All-America Game. Brown graduated early from high school and enrolled at Alabama in January 2014, where he began participating in both football and track and field. His college career included a mix of achievements and challenges, including a suspension for starting a fight while preparing for the 2015 Cotton Bowl.
Tony Brown Career
Early Career (2018)
Tony Brown went undrafted in the 2018 NFL Draft despite running a 4.35 second 40-yard dash, one of the fastest times at the combine. He signed with the Los Angeles Chargers as an undrafted free agent on April 28, 2018, but was waived on September 1, 2018. Shortly after, he joined the practice squad of the Green Bay Packers on September 3, 2018, and was promoted to the active roster on September 29, 2018. Brown played for the Packers until December 28, 2019, when he was released.
Breakthrough (2019-2021)
After being claimed off waivers by the Cincinnati Bengals on December 30, 2019, Tony Brown signed a one-year contract extension with the team on March 12, 2020. He made his first career start in Week 10 of the 2020 season, recording six tackles, two for a loss, and a pass deflection. Brown re-signed with the Bengals on another one-year contract on March 18, 2021, but was waived on August 31, 2021, and later re-signed to the practice squad.
Notable Works and Milestones
Throughout his career, Tony Brown has played for several NFL teams, showcasing his skills as a cornerback. He has recorded significant statistics, including a total of 80 tackles, one sack, four forced fumbles, seven pass deflections, and one interception as of 2024.
